How Mega Millions Works
The mechanics of Mega Millions are straightforward, making it accessible to anybody who wants to get involved. Players should choose 5 numbers from a swimming pool of white balls numbered 1 through 70, and one extra number called the Mega Ball from a separate pool of gold balls numbered 1 through 25. To win the jackpot, a gamer should match all 6 numbers drawn throughout the official drawing. Nevertheless, there are several reward tiers, meaning players can win considerable quantities even without matching all numbers.
Drawings take place two times weekly, providing routine chances for individuals to evaluate their luck. The anticipation between drawings creates a recurring cycle of excitement and hope that keeps players engaged. Each illustration is performed with strict security measures and openness procedures to guarantee fairness and preserve public trust in the game’s integrity.
The odds of winning vary depending on the prize tier. While the chances of hitting the mark are admittedly high, the game offers 9 various methods to win rewards. This multi-tier structure indicates that even if gamers don’t win the grand reward, they still have opportunities to win smaller sized but still considerable amounts. This design element contributes to the video game’s sustained popularity, as it offers more regular wins that keep gamers motivated and engaged.
The Prize Structure and Payouts
Mega Millions features a thorough reward structure that rewards different levels of number matching. The jackpot, which starts at a significant base amount, represents the ultimate prize for matching all five white balls plus the Mega Ball. When somebody wins the jackpot, it resets to the starting amount for the next illustration. If nobody wins, the jackpot rolls over, adding more money to the reward swimming pool for the subsequent drawing.
Beyond the jackpot, there are 8 extra reward tiers. Matching 5 white balls without the Mega Ball usually awards a substantial second-tier reward. The remaining prize levels correspond to different combinations of matched white balls and the Mega Ball, with prizes reducing as less numbers are matched. Even matching just the Mega Ball alone results in a small reward, ensuring that the video game offers value at multiple levels.
Winners face an essential decision regarding how they get their jackpot: as an annuity paid out over several decades or as a lump sum money payment. The annuity alternative offers the full advertised jackpot amount dispersed in annual installments, with each payment increasing a little to represent inflation. The cash choice uses instant access to the reward but at a lowered quantity, typically representing the actual money in the reward pool. Each option has distinct financial ramifications, and winners often talk to monetary consultants to identify the best option for their circumstances.
The Mathematics Behind the Game
Comprehending the mathematical probability of Mega Millions assists players approach the game with sensible expectations. The chances of winning the jackpot are approximately 1 in 302 million, reflecting the enormous number of possible number mixes. These odds, while intimidating, are in fact what enable the prizes to grow to such remarkable sizes, as the rarity of jackpot wins allows prizes to build up over numerous illustrations.
The odds improve considerably for lower reward tiers. For example, matching 5 white balls has odds of roughly 1 in 12.6 million, while matching four white balls plus the Mega Ball has chances of about 1 in 931,000. The total chances of winning any prize in Mega Millions are approximately 1 in 24, making smaller sized wins relatively typical and maintaining gamer interest in between significant jackpot events.
These mathematical truths underscore an essential principle: lottery video games should be viewed as home entertainment rather than financial investment techniques. The unfavorable expected value indicates that, usually, players will invest more on tickets than they get in earnings. However, the home entertainment worth, the excitement of participation, and the possibility of a life-changing win provide intangible advantages that numerous discover worthwhile.
Methods and Myths
Numerous players establish personal strategies for picking numbers, though it’s essential to understand that Mega Millions is a game of pure opportunity. Some prefer selecting considerable dates like birthdays and anniversaries, while others opt for random choices or utilize different mathematical patterns. From a mathematical standpoint, no selection method increases the likelihood of winning, as each number combination has an equal chance of being drawn.
One consideration worth keeping in mind is that selecting popular number combinations, such as sequences or typically picked numbers, doesn’t minimize your opportunities of winning but might imply sharing the jackpot with more individuals if those numbers are drawn. Alternatively, selecting less common number combinations will not improve your chances of winning but could lead to a bigger specific payout if you do win, as you ‘d be less likely to split the prize.
Many myths surround lottery video games, and Mega Millions is no exception. Some believe that certain numbers are “due” to be drawn based on previous outcomes, however each illustration is an independent event without any connection to previous outcomes. Other misconceptions suggest that specific retailers or locations are “luckier” than others, but this understanding normally arises from higher sales volume at those areas rather than any actual benefit.
The Social and Economic Impact
Mega Millions creates significant income, with a considerable portion allocated to different public purposes. While the precise distribution varies by jurisdiction, lottery earnings normally support education, facilities, environmental programs, and other public initiatives. This element allows gamers to feel that their participation contributes to community benefits, even when they don’t win rewards.
The economic effect extends beyond public funding. Big prizes create economic activity through increased ticket sales, media protection, and public interest. Retailers take advantage of commissions on ticket sales and perks for offering winning tickets. The enjoyment surrounding major jackpots can develop a short-lived boost in regional economies as people collect to acquire tickets and discuss the possibilities.
However, lottery games likewise raise important social factors to consider. Critics point to concerns about issue betting and the regressive nature of lottery involvement, keeping in mind that lower-income individuals often spend an out of proportion portion of their earnings on tickets. These issues have led to increased emphasis on accountable gaming messages and resources for those who may develop unhealthy gambling habits.

The Psychology of Playing
The appeal of Mega Millions extends beyond simple mathematics into the world of human psychology. The game take advantage of fundamental elements of hope, imagination, and the universal desire for monetary security and freedom. When prizes reach extraordinary levels, they control news cycles and social conversations, developing a shared cultural experience that transcends the specific act of buying a ticket.
Psychologists note that lottery play supplies an opportunity for positive fantasizing about how life may alter with unexpected wealth. This mental exercise can be satisfying and even restorative in small amounts, permitting people to think of possibilities and dream about their perfect futures. The little financial investment needed for a ticket seems trivial compared to the magnitude of the possible reward, making involvement feel like a sensible exchange for the home entertainment worth and hope it offers.
However, this very same psychological appeal can end up being troublesome when people start to view lottery play as a sensible course to financial improvement rather than entertainment. The “accessibility heuristic,” a cognitive bias where people overstate the possibility of occasions they can quickly remember, can lead players to think their opportunities are much better than they really are, especially after hearing stories of recent winners. Keeping viewpoint on the true odds assists keep expectations realistic.
